Spring Grooming: Handling Shedding and Allergic Reactions
As the days expand warmer and blossoms begin to bloom, your canine may begin shedding even more hair, which can cause allergies for both you and your pet.

Additionally, vacuum your home regularly to lower irritants and take into consideration utilizing air purifiers. Bathing your pet dog with a gentle hair shampoo can likewise aid reduce itchy skin.
If allergic reactions persist, consult your vet for recommendations on pet-safe antihistamines or therapies. By remaining proactive, you'll keep your canine comfy and decrease allergy signs and symptoms for everybody in your house.
Summer Season Grooming: Protecting Against Warmth and Pests
When summer season rolls in, maintaining your dog great and shielded from pests ends up being a top concern. Routine pet grooming aids handle your pup's coat, decreasing warm and preventing matting.
Take into consideration a summertime hairstyle for longer-haired breeds; it not only boosts air flow however likewise makes it less complicated to spot insects like fleas and ticks.
Do not forget to shower your canine extra often with a gentle, pet-safe hair shampoo to get rid of dirt and bugs. After outside play, examine their skin for any kind of signs of irritability or parasites.

Winter Grooming: Keeping Your Canine Warm and Comfy
While winter season brings a cool to the air, maintaining your dog warm and comfy is vital for their health. Normal pet grooming assists preserve a healthy and balanced layer, which provides insulation versus the cold.
Make sure to comb your canine regularly to stop matting and get rid of dead hair, as a tidy layer traps heat better. Consider scheduling a trim for longer-haired breeds to lower ice and snow build-up between their paws and on their hair.
